Overview of the Three Visa Types
Australia offers multiple points-tested pathways under the General Skilled Migration (GSM) program. These include:
• Subclass 189 – Skilled Independent Visa
• Subclass 190 – Skilled Nominated Visa
• Subclass 491 – Skilled Work Regional (Provisional) Visa
Subclass 189 – Skilled Independent Visa
The Subclass 189 visa is a permanent residency visa that doesn’t require state or employer sponsorship. It’s ideal for candidates with high points and in-demand skills. To apply, you must receive an invitation through SkillSelect.
Subclass 190 – Skilled Nominated Visa
Subclass 190 requires a nomination from an Australian state or territory. It’s also a permanent residency visa, but you must commit to living and working in the nominating state for at least two years. This option benefits those with lower points but strong ties to a particular region.
Subclass 491 – Skilled Work Regional (Provisional) Visa
The 491 visa is a five-year provisional visa that requires nomination by a regional area or sponsorship by an eligible relative. It offers a pathway to permanent residency after three years of work and living in a regional area. This route is best for those willing to settle outside metro zones.
Points System Comparison
The minimum points required for all three visas is 65. However, higher scores increase your chances of receiving an invitation.
• 189 Visa – Competitive, usually needs 85+ points
• 190 Visa – Nomination adds 5 points
• 491 Visa – Nomination adds 15 points
